Quoting Ville Syrj?l? (syrjala@sci.fi): > That should be 0.9.16. Typo? > > > applied the patches to kernel 2.4.18 > > (SuSE-80), compiled mplayer-CVS20030202. Well. Mplayer does not offer a > > "-vo dfbmga", only a "-vo directfb". Is this normal/OK? > > No. dfbmga should be built if DirectFB >= 0.9.13 is installed. Does mplayer use pkg-config? I yes, please try to "export PKG_CONFIG_PATH=/usr/local/lib/pkgconfig" or whatever prefix you used. > > Whenever I try to output to -vo directfb from X11, screen0 gets dark and I > > have to reboot. Started from console mplayer returns my screen after end of > > movie. > > You must use XDirectFB.
